Subject: Cut-over summary — Quarrow matching service GC tuning

On-call, please read before your shift. Last night we cut the Quarrow matching service over to the new generational collector after sustained pause spikes were blamed for missed match windows. Post-cut-over, p99 pauses are well under the alert threshold, but heap occupancy now sits higher at steady state — that is expected, do not page on it alone. Rollback remains possible until Thursday. For reference during incidents, the service is now running with the following values.

config for kafof-bawef:
holath:
  log_level: debug
  metrics_host: metrics.holath.qorvelsys.internal
  pin: 2191
  pool_size: 32

Internal Memo — Corven Retail Partners

Board members: quick update on the revised commission scheme. We've swapped the flat 3% for a tiered model rewarding multi-year deals — the field teams in Pellbrook piloted it and, honestly, they liked it more than we expected. Payout costs rise slightly but churn should fall. Full modelling is attached; the confidential rationale follows below.

board note of fahog-bawep: The renewal with Holixax Holdings closes at $20 million a year, 20 percent below the last contract. Project Druwyn slips by two quarters because of the supplier delay.

Action item from the Mirewater tide-table widget incident. Owner: release manager. Widget cached stale harbor offsets after the DST change, showing tides six hours off for two days. Required: add a cache-invalidation check to the release checklist, block deploys when offset tables are older than 24 hours, and verify the Saltgate harbor feed before each cut. Deadline: next release. Checklist template and sign-off procedure are documented on the internal page below.

wiki page, kawif-bajep: https://artifactory.zarqelforge.internal/issue/browse/display/display/projects/spaces/secrets/000fe6ec5a46af29355003e1